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ost in Montgomery Village, MD
The cost of Wet Vacuum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Montgomery Village, MD. You can expect the following price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$100 - $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water Extraction | $500 - $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 - $1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Inspection and Cleaning | $100 - $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you know what to expect. You can trust our team to provide transparent and honest pricing for all our services.
